
Indians Fall in Extra Innings to AquaSox
Published on September 3, 2015 under Northwest League (NWL1)
Spokane Indians News Release
SPOKANE, Wash. - Everett's Taylor Zeutenhorst hit a two-run home run to right field in the 12th inning, giving the AquaSox an 8-5 victory over the Spokane Indians in front of 4,554 fans at Avista Stadium on Wednesday night. It was Fan Appreciation Night presented by Rock 94 ½ and KXLY-AM 920. The win clinched the second-half title for the AquaSox, and eliminated the Indians from postseason contention.
Spokane screamed out to an early three-run lead in the first inning after Darius Day singled, advanced to third on an error and finally scored on a wild pitch. Leon Byrd Jr., doubled home LeDarious Clark and Sherman Lacrus.
In the fifth inning with the bases loaded, Dean Long scored on a balk from AquaSox pitcher Rohn Pierce. In the same at-bat, Day scored on a passed ball.
Day finished 3-for-6 with two runs scored and one double. Clark went 0-for-2 with one run scored and three walks.
Spokane starter Emerson Martinez tossed 4.2 innings and allowed four runs - one earned - with one strikeout. Cole Wiper pitched a near-perfect three innings late in the game to lower his ERA to 4.00. Indians utility man Diego Cedeno made his pitching debut, getting the final out in the 12th.
